Oxidation of powders of some oxygen-free refractory compounds

Description

A temeparture of the initiol oxidation stage of powders of titanium, vanadium, niobium, tantalum, higher chromium monocarbide, tantalum, tungsten and molybdenum disilicides, zirconium diboride and also titanium carbonitride was determined by using a derivatigraph. The oxidation rate for these powders was studied at 800 deg C in air depending on the oxidation time. It is shown that the lowest oxidation rate is featured by chromium carbide. The ellectric resistance of the powders in the process of their oxidation was measured. The variations in the resistance of the chromium carbide powder was found to be smaller than that of the other materials studied
